Several types of connectivity choices are sometimes employed in smart cities, every with unique traits and capabilities. Cellular networks, for example, offer widespread protection and higher knowledge throughput. They allow IoT units to communicate effectively, especially in areas the place different forms of connectivity could additionally be limited. Many smart metropolis purposes rely on cellular know-how to ensure constant information streaming and interaction.


Low-Power Wide-Area Networks, or LPWAN, is one other prominent possibility. This technology is designed particularly for low-bandwidth and low-power functions. LPWAN is particularly helpful for sensor data, making it best for smart agriculture, waste administration, and environmental monitoring. The long-range capabilities of LPWAN also imply fewer base stations are required, making deployment extra economical.


Wi-Fi is often used for connecting gadgets in more localized smart metropolis deployments. This possibility is effective for city areas with current infrastructure, allowing numerous gadgets to connect without incurring important costs. However, Wi-Fi connections can wrestle by way of range and battery life for distant IoT gadgets. Solutions to enhance Wi-Fi protection can embody mesh networks that extend connectivity.

Another notable interplay know-how employed in smart cities is Zigbee. This low-power, short-range wi-fi communication standard serves various purposes from lighting methods to home automation. Zigbee is especially useful in dense city settings the place many units are in close proximity to one another, providing a sturdy option for native mesh networks.

Bluetooth can additionally be making significant inroads within the smart metropolis panorama. Its low energy consumption and ease of use make it a well-liked selection for connecting personal devices to metropolis infrastructure. Applications corresponding to smart parking techniques and public transport apps make the most of Bluetooth connectivity to streamline companies for customers.


Fiber optic networks present another layer of IoT connectivity options, especially for the spine infrastructure of smart cities. They help high data switch charges and may handle substantial quantities of knowledge from various sensors and systems. This possibility is significant for central knowledge centers, guaranteeing that the immense quantity of data generated by smart metropolis gadgets is efficiently processed.


The integration of satellite expertise is a growing trends, particularly for rural or underconnected areas. This choice allows cities to achieve far-flung units that traditional networks won't service successfully. While satellite tv for pc connectivity may not be as low in latency as different options, it's important for complete smart city protection.

    What are the most typical IoT connectivity options for smart cities?





Common IoT connectivity choices for smart cities embrace cellular networks (like 4G/5G), LPWAN (Low Power Wide Area Network) technologies such as LoRaWAN and Sigfox, Wi-Fi, and Bluetooth. Each has its strengths, serving varied applications relying on range, energy consumption, and data fee necessities.


How does 5G improve IoT connectivity in city areas?


5G enhances IoT connectivity by offering sooner knowledge switch speeds, lower latency, and the ability to attach a massive variety of devices concurrently. This is crucial for purposes like smart traffic administration and real-time public safety monitoring, thereby enhancing overall urban effectivity.

What function does LPWAN play in smart metropolis applications?




LPWAN is designed particularly for low-power, long-range communication, go right here making it best for battery-operated sensors and gadgets in smart cities. LPWAN can help wide-area coverage with minimal energy consumption, which is especially useful for applications like waste administration and environmental monitoring.
